Water Filtration Installation in Houston, TX
Water filtration installation services provide homeowners with systems designed to improve the quality of their household water supply. These projects typically include installing point-of-use filters, whole-house filtration systems, or specialty units to remove contaminants such as chlorine, sediment, or other impurities. Property owners often request this service when seeking cleaner, better-tasting water, or to address specific concerns related to health, appliance longevity, or water odor. Understanding the different types of filtration options and their suitability for a property's water source is an important consideration before requesting installation.
Homeowners usually want to know about the compatibility of filtration systems with their existing plumbing, the maintenance requirements, and the expected benefits of each type of system. It’s also helpful to consider the size of the property, the number of water fixtures, and any specific water quality issues that need to be addressed. Clarifying these details can ensure the selected filtration system effectively meets household needs and provides a reliable solution for cleaner, safer water throughout the home.

Common Water Filtration Installation Jobs
Whole House Water Filtration - improves water quality for every tap in the home.
Under-Sink Filtration Systems - provides filtered water directly at kitchen sinks.
Point-of-Use Filters - targets specific appliances or fixtures for cleaner water.
Reverse Osmosis Installations - removes contaminants for drinking and cooking water.
Water Softener and Filtration Combos - reduces hardness and improves water clarity.
Custom Water Filtration Solutions - tailored systems to meet specific property water needs.
